Mark Deal as Won

Once a qualified lead results in a sale, you can mark the deal as Won to close it successfully.

Things to Keep in Mind
  1. Owners and Managers can mark any deal as Won.
  2. Deals are automatically marked as Won when a customer purchases the attached plan via the shared link, but you can also manually mark a deal as Won.
  3. Marking a deal as Won moves it to the Closed view.
How to Mark a Deal as Won
  1. Go to Leads: Navigate to Leads from your sidebar.
  2. Find the Deal: Locate the lead that is currently marked as Qualified.
  3. Update the Status: From the summary view, mark the deal as Won, and confirm changes.
